A practice for the nervous system, a studio for the senses, a quiet rebellion against the noise.

We believe the breath is the most underused instrument we carry. It steadies the racing mind, sharpens the artist's eye, and trims the sail when the wind shifts. It is, simply, the way back into the body — and into the present.

Toronto Breathwork is built on three living pillars: foundational breath practice, creative exploration in nature, and movement on water. Each one is an entry point to the same place. We call it flow.

Create is a slow studio for the contemporary maker — a practice that uses breath to soften the inner critic and open the door to intuitive, embodied creation.

We forage pigments from urban trees. We paint en plein air on the Toronto Islands. We marble paper in spring water, ferment indigo, and treat creativity as an ecological act.

For artists, designers, architects, and innovation teams, these workshops are a return to the analog — and a quiet sharpening of the senses.

Founder
Led by a sailor since 2008

Jeyda raced internationally and trained with the all-women's Canadian Olympic Match Race team. On-water experiences run with vetted, certified charter partners — Lake Ontario and the Adriatic.
